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ryEVELYN (EVIE) FLORENCE FRITH Evelyn (Evie) Florence Frith passed away Saturday April 25, 2009 in Swan Lake Hospital at the age of 97 years. She was predeceased by her beloved husband H. Irwin Frith; her four sisters, Edith Arnold, Olive Frith, Gladys Hagyard, Edna Hutchinson and their husbands; her parents Thomas and Matilda Manning. She is mourned by her son Ralph and daughter-in-law Evelyn; grandson Kenton (Deirdre); granddaughter Rayna; granddaughter Shanna (Kurt); great-grandchildren Torin and Rowan Frith; Seren and Kate Mazur; numerous nephews and nieces. Evie was born in the Gowancroft District and grew up in Londesboro District and Pilot Mound, Manitoba. She married Irwin Frith in 1935. Their life through the Depression (Dirty Thirties) did much to shape her character. She was hard working, frugal, traditional and firm in her faith. She was an enthusiastic gardener and tireless knitter until, in the last few years, ill health interfered. Her greatest joy was her grandchildren and great-grandchildren. All her family and many, many friends will sadly miss her. A funeral service was held in Pilot Mound United Church, Saturday May 2 with Graham Funeral Service in care of arrangements; Rev Irene Onuch officiating.
